Monetization Strategies in Chicken Road Games
While the gameplay itself is often free, most chicken road games employ various monetization strategies to generate revenue. These commonly include in-app advertisements, in-app purchases, and rewarded video ads. Advertisements are often strategically placed between game sessions or after a certain number of failures, providing a non-intrusive revenue stream. In-app purchases typically allow players to acquire cosmetic items, such as different chicken skins or road themes, or to remove advertisements altogether. Rewarded video ads offer players the opportunity to earn extra lives, points, or boosts by watching short video clips. The key to successful monetization is to strike a balance between generating revenue and maintaining a positive player experience. Overly aggressive advertising or predatory in-app purchase schemes can quickly alienate players.

The Technical Aspects of Developing a Chicken Road Game
Developing a chicken road game might seem straightforward, but it requires careful consideration of several technical factors. Game development engines like Unity and Godot are commonly used for creating these games due to their ease of use, cross-platform compatibility, and extensive asset stores. The core programming logic involves defining the movement of the chicken, the speed and patterns of the oncoming traffic, collision detection, and scoring mechanisms. Optimizing the game for performance is crucial, especially on mobile devices, to ensure smooth gameplay and minimal battery drain. This might involve techniques like object pooling to reduce memory allocation and efficient rendering strategies. Utilizing simple, vector-based graphics can also help improve performance. The integration of advertising SDKs (Software Development Kits) is also a critical step, allowing developers to monetize their game through in-app advertisements.
Utilizing Game Development Engines
Game development engines provide a comprehensive suite of tools and features that streamline the creation process. These engines handle many of the low-level technical details, allowing developers to focus on the core gameplay mechanics and user experience. Unity, for example, offers a visual editor, scripting capabilities (using C), and a vast asset store containing pre-made assets like graphics, sounds, and code snippets. Godot, an open-source engine, provides a similar set of features, with the added benefit of being entirely free to use. The choice of engine often depends on the developer’s experience, project requirements, and budget. These platforms accelerate the development cycle, allowing for rapid prototyping and iteration.
